Night crew, quick reminder: the Brightmop cleaning team comes through Varden House between 11 pm and 2 am. They're fine to roam the open-plan floors, but someone from our shift has to walk them into the server corridor. Don't lend them your own badge. Instead, let them in using the shared night-access code below.

staff pass of kagef-yahip = bdg-TKELFT-63915354

TICKET — Missed Pick-up, Pinefold Print Co.

Hi — the afternoon run skipped us again, so the master copies for the Lanward brochure job are still sitting at reception. These are the only clean originals, so we'd rather not leave them out overnight. Can you get a courier back today? The confidential hand-over instruction is noted just below.

courier memo of tawep-tajep: the quenius ulaiel courier leaves the fenir ledger at gate 9128 under passcode 527513

Loading dock — delivery hours. Deliveries accepted 07:00–11:00 and 14:00–16:30, weekdays only. No weekend access without prior sign-off from the Torfield site lead. Reverse in from Cobbler's Yard; do not block the ramp. Pallets over 500 kg need the dock plate, booked a day ahead. Visiting contractors must sign in at the dock office, wear hi-vis past the yellow line, and keep engines off while waiting. The dock shutter is keypad-operated outside staffed hours; enter the code below at the side panel.

staff pass of kawip-hawef = bdg-QLP-2